Bria Hartley’s Long Road of Injuries

To be clear, Bria Hartley’s injury woes are not new. This meniscus tear marks her third season-ending knee issue in just five years. She previously battled through two ACL tears in 2020 and 2022. For any athlete, that kind of history is brutal — for fans, it’s tragic.

But because of the rivalry context, Hartley’s misfortune has been rebranded as “poetic justice.” Fair? Probably not. But in the world of sports media and fandom, perception often overshadows reality.
